Tori Carter and Kirk Rickman transformed their lives by selling their home and embracing full-time cruising in December 2022. Motivated by personal losses and a serious injury, they decided to fulfill their dream of traversing the seas. Since then, they have embarked on 29 cruises, visiting destinations like Buenos Aires, Antarctica, and Lisbon. Using rental income to finance their travels, they estimate spending less than a month on land in over two years, with aspirations to continue their cruising lifestyle for as long as possible.
First, her friend died suddenly. Her dog, who she loved like a son, followed shortly after. Then, she suffered a serious back injury. "It all happened at the same time," Carter, 55, told Business Insider. "It felt like everything accumulated to saying, 'now is the time. Do what you want to do now.'"
